Definitions of unkindness word

  • adjective unkindness lacking in kindness or mercy; severe. 1
  • noun unkindness (Uncountable Noun) The state or quality of being unkind. 0
  • noun unkindness (Countable Noun) An unkind act. 0
  • noun unkindness (Countable Noun) The collective noun for ravens. 0

Origin of unkindness

First appearance:

before 1200
One of the 9% oldest English words
Middle English word dating back to 1200-50; See origin at un-1, kind1
